Summary

Rocket Close built a solution called Supercharger using Strands Agents, large language models (LLMs), Amazon Bedrock, Amazon Bedrock Knowledge Bases, and Model Context Protocol (MCP) tools to optimize title operations. The blog post details the solution features, technology stack rationale, lessons learned, and business impact.

Why it matters

This case study demonstrates how agentic AI can streamline complex operational workflows in the title industry, potentially reducing manual effort and errors. By leveraging AWS services and MCP tools, Rocket Close achieved measurable improvements, showcasing a practical application of generative AI in a regulated business domain.

Impact on AI tools/models

The integration of LLMs with knowledge bases and MCP tools highlights a trend toward composable AI architectures. This approach allows businesses to combine retrieval-augmented generation (RAG) with agentic workflows, improving accuracy and context-awareness in task automation.
